This series include changes in driver code to investigate potential
code savings. As example used the ath9k driver as it has a fair
amount of debugfs files. In this series it changes 7 debugfs entries
to use seq_file and the helper function. Below the output of the
size utility:

    text           data     bss     dec     hex filename
  115968           1225      28  117221   1c9e5 original/ath9k.o
  113224           1225      28  114477   1bf2d seq_file/ath9k.o
  111024           1225      28  112277   1b695 helper/ath9k.o
